SAN DIEGO -- San Diego Gay & Lesbian News will hold a “Meet the LGBT Candidates” forum later this month at Anthology, 1337 India St.
The forum will be from 5:30 to 7:30 p.m. Monday, Aug. 30, at the chic supper club.
The free event is designed to give the community a chance to meet its current and prospective LGBT elected officials.
Scheduled to attend are San Diego District Attorney Bonnie Dumanis, San Diego City Councilmembers Carl DeMaio and Todd Gloria, Solana Beach City Councilmember David Roberts, Democratic state Assembly candidate Toni Atkins, Republican state Assembly candidate Ralph Denney, San Diego County Board of Supervisors candidate Stephen Whitburn and San Diego school board candidate Kevin Beiser.
“It is vital for the strength and stability of our community to have openly LGBT elected officials looking out for our best interests,” said Johnathan Hale, publisher of SDGLN and San Diego Pix. “It is essential that we continue to support LGBT candidates.”
William Rodriguez-Kennedy, president of Log Cabin Republicans of San Diego, noted the number of LGBT candidates and/or elected officials.
The fact that San Diego has “LGBT candidates and LGBT elected officials on both sides of the aisle truly speaks volumes. It shows that we are making great strides in our march to equality and that our fight is not a partisan issue,” he said.
Denis Dison, vice president of external affairs for the Gay & Lesbian Victory Fund and Leadership Institute, said San Diego is a model for the rest of the country.
"San Diego is a Victory Fund success story. The LGBT community there has really embraced our mission, which is to change politics by electing openly LGBT candidates for public office,” Dison said.
“Some of the city's true LGBT heroes have been its elected officials, and we're proud to have played a role in that."
Also sponsoring the forum are San Diego PIX Magazine, Uptown News, Gay San Diego, FlawLess, Lavender Lens and BottomLine magazine.
